[newbie] financial accounting (2)
 
I'm trying to calculate a formula as follows:

Effective interest rate =
principal amount / (principal amount - interest paid upfront - loan charges)
- 1

I have updated this as:

=(D60/(D60-D62+D63)) -1

Whe
D60 = Principal amount, say ぎ100,000.00
D62 = interest paid upfront , say 10% of the principal amount, ぎ10,000.00
D63 = loan charges, say ぎ2000.00

I am getting a result of 8.7%, whilst when working it out with a calculator
it comes out to around 14% (13.64%).

Any ideas where my mistake is?


MS Excel 2007
